Capacity note for the Bramblewick export retry queue. Failed exports are requeued with exponential backoff, and the queue depth is our main capacity signal: sustained depth above the high-water mark means downstream Pellis storage is saturated, not that we need more workers. As the new contractor, please don't raise worker counts without checking storage latency first — it usually makes things worse. Retry timing, backoff caps, and the high-water threshold are all driven by the constants shown below.

limits module of yagef-bajog:
TIERS = {
    "druael": 370,
    "tamix": 286,
    "pelius": 541,
    "pelael": 78,
    "pelox": 47,
    "ralath": 533,
    "drumir": 801,
}

## Deployment

Fabrikary, our test-data factory library, ships as part of the Moorhen service bundle and needs no separate install. Support staff reproducing customer issues should deploy the sandbox profile, which seeds deterministic fixtures on startup. Seeding runs once per container boot; re-runs are idempotent. If fixtures look stale, restart the pod rather than editing rows by hand. The factory reads its settings at boot, and the current sandbox values are listed below.

config for tawif-bagef:
[sorwyn]
team = sorys
access_code = ac_9ba40c
host = sorwyn.ordingrid.local
port = 5000
owner = aldok.quenion
peer = belath.paliqcloud.local

Ticket: DOCLINT-412 — Prosewright linter flags valid anchor syntax

The Prosewright documentation linter incorrectly reports broken cross-references when headings contain em dashes. This blocks merges on the Harrowgate docs repo. As a new contractor, you don't need deep context: reproduce with the sample page in the fixtures folder, then check rule `anchors-resolve`. Attach your run output when commenting. For triage, include the trace token shown below.

session token of yahof-bajeg = htk9_0d43d44ed